#badbe2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#badbe2 is composed of 72.9% red, 85.9%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.7% cyan, 3.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 190.5 degrees, a saturation of 40.8% and a lightness of 80.8%. #badbe2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#75b7c5.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#badbe2 color description : Light grayish cyan.
#badbe2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#badbe2 has RGB values of R:186, G:219,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 12245986.
